country food restaurant in Addo
About 2 results.
Woodall Country House | Addo Elephant Park
Jan Smuts Avenue, 6105 Addo, South AfricaAddo Guest House Accommodation Nestled in the heart of the Sundays River Valley, on the doorstep of Addo Elephant Park, and http://www.woodall-addo.co.za/